Sep 12, 2023 · Crossbow Limbs. The limbs of a crossbow are the design’s unsung heroes. Crossbows used to be made of flexible wood, but now they can be made of a wide range of materials, such as aluminum and carbon fiber. These limbs extend symmetrically from the center of the crossbow and are attached to either end of the bowstring.

Limb manufacturing is fundamentally the same between beginner and advanced limbs ... July 21, 2023. Inspecting your crossbow limbs is quite an easy task. A thorough visual inspection under good lighting will reveal defects such as chips, cracks and splintering. Please note that the level of damage must be substantial for a relaxed limb to reveal problems at this phase of inspection. Once you have given the limbs a good thorough ...Crossbow limbs crack for various reasons. However, the most common cause can be either of these two: manufacturing defects and accidental or intentional dry firing of a crossbow. The limbs are among the most important parts of a compound bow. If a catastrophic failure occurs, it’s typically in the limbs. The limbs take a good amount of energy at the shot and are under constant bend and flex. The string is attached to the cams and when it is pulled back, the wheels turn. This motion bends the limbs and stores a large amount of kinetic energy, which is then released once the trigger is pulled. These wheels can be round or oval shaped. Iron crossbow limbs are required to make an iron crossbow. They can be smithed from 1 iron bar at Smithing level 10, granting 40 experience. Iron crossbow limbs can be attached to a willow stock at Fletching level 39, granting 22 experience, to make an unstrung iron crossbow. They can also be purchased from crossbow shops, such as the one in ... Blurite crossbow limbs are required to make a blurite crossbow. They can be smithed from a blurite bar at Smithing level 10, granting 40 experience. Blurite limbs can be attached to an oak stock at Fletching level 24, granting 32 experience, to make an unstrung blurite crossbow.
